Output ddfd1729374daa5af610234c4fa657fbf55a9291d5328e86af9ceac3ba27e00e:125

value
516885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04246d4bccae7127f97c16925ab55fa051423b20 OP_EQUAL
address
324vGJJPYAk1TjYfsYW6AemRy5cMSF2tWX
transaction
ddfd1729374daa5af610234c4fa657fbf55a9291d5328e86af9ceac3ba27e00e
spent
true